Ask the professional concerning lumen result for the proposed system, and how the illumination compares to your current lights. Are the numbers comparable? A lot of lumens (i.e., lights that are too bright) are as big of a headache as also few lumens (i.e., it's so dark I can not see my hands).
"However wait, why not just ask just how bright the lights are?" Inquiring about "lumens" specifically helps you learn more about your contractor along with your proposed lighting. Your illumination contractor should know the lumen rating for the suggested system. If they do not, there's really no requirement to maintain inquiring concerns.

The temperature level of the light is reduced, yet the shade is warmer. Similarly, greater temperature lights (4500k-6500k) are "cooler" in shade trending towards blue. An excellent reference point is to bear in mind that the temperature of direct sunlight at noontime has to do with 5600K.
